Where White Label Rx fits a med spa

White Label Rx's multi-pharmacy model is a natural fit for a med spa because a spa's formulary spans categories that rarely come from a single pharmacy. Consolidating GLP-1s, peptides, hair restoration, and wellness compounds into one dashboard — instead of a separate login per pharmacy — is exactly the problem White Label Rx markets against, and that breadth is the headline benefit for a multi-service spa.

The two things to confirm are catalog coverage and pricing visibility. White Label Rx does not publish a complete formulary, so a spa should verify in a demo that every category on its menu is actually available across the partner network. And because White Label Rx directs clinics to a custom quote, per-item cost is not visible until a sales conversation — which matters when you price treatments one menu line at a time.

The mixed-formulary pitfalls to test

A spa ordering across categories hits two pitfalls. First, fragmentation: if items route to different pharmacies, can you still build one cart and pay once, or does a single restock become several checkouts? Second, validation: across many SIGs and protocols, a wrong direction or a licensure gap is easy to miss, and catching it after payment means a rejected order and a delayed treatment.
